Understanding Neuroplasticity


Neuroplasticity is the brain's ability to reorganize itself through forming new neural connections. This adaptability can help individuals recover from brain injuries, adjust to new learning experiences, or cope with the changes that come with aging or disease. There are two main types of neuroplasticity: structural and functional.


  • Structural neuroplasticity involves physical changes to the brain's structure. For instance, studies show that when individuals learn a new skill, such as playing a musical instrument, the corresponding areas of the brain undergo structural changes to accommodate the new information.

  • Functional neuroplasticity refers to the brain’s ability to shift functions from damaged areas to healthier ones. After a stroke, for example, undamaged parts of the brain can take over functions lost due to the injury, enabling recovery.

Acupuncture: A Brief Overview


Acupuncture involves inserting thin needles into specific points on the body, known as acupoints. These points are believed to align with pathways that facilitate the flow of energy, or qi, throughout the body. The goal of acupuncture is to restore balance, relieve pain, and enhance overall well-being. Emerging research suggests that acupuncture may also stimulate neuroplasticity, making it a potentially effective therapy for various neurological conditions.


For example, a study found that patients with post-stroke recovery exhibited a 30% improvement in motor skills following regular acupuncture sessions. This suggests that acupuncture could not only improve physical function but also encourage neuroplastic changes in the brain related to motor control.


The Link Between Acupuncture and Neuroplasticity


Research indicates that acupuncture can positively affect the brain's neuroplastic capabilities. By stimulating acupoints, acupuncture may promote the release of neurotransmitters and neurotrophic factors. These substances are essential for creating and maintaining neural connections. Enhanced neuroplasticity can lead to significant improvements in brain function and recovery processes after injuries like stroke or traumatic brain injury.


Additionally, acupuncture may aid in managing chronic pain conditions, such as fibromyalgia and diabetic neuropathy. Studies show that individuals with fibromyalgia who received acupuncture reported a 50% reduction in pain and an improved quality of life. Acupuncture seems to encourage neuroplastic changes in brain pathways associated with pain perception, offering hope to those suffering from persistent pain.
